As a leading hotel group, we're seeking an experienced CIAM (Customer Identity & Access Management) Technical Advisor to play a key role in securing guest identity and preventing fraud within the CIAM landscape. This role focuses on advising strategy, security, and implementation of CIAM solutions, ensuring compliance with industry standards, and enhancing fraud detection and prevention capabilities.
Your Day-to-Day:
As a CIAM Technical Advisor at arenaflex, you'll collaborate with cross-functional teams (security, architecture, engineering, fraud, compliance) to develop CIAM roadmaps and security enhancements. You'll provide technical advisory services for CIAM strategy, fraud prevention, and risk-based authentication. You'll work across multiple business and technical partner relationships to implement security best practices, industry regulations (GDPR, CCPA), and business objectives. Some of your key responsibilities will include:
- Designing, architecting, and implementing the modernization of access management for our guests, partners, and API solutions, with particular focus on user experience.
- Driving the adoption of modern authentication mechanisms (OAuth 2.0, OpenID Connect, FIDO2, WebAuthn) to improve security and user experience.
- Designing, architecting, and implementing anti-fraud technologies across multiple areas including credit card and account registration.
- Working to improve the resiliency and scalability of our platform ecosystem with support partners.
- Supporting Decentralized Identity (DID) and self-sovereign identity initiatives for improved user control and compliance.
What We Need From You:
To succeed in this role, you'll need:
- 8+ years in IAM, CIAM, or security roles with a focus on fraud prevention.
- Deep knowledge of OAuth, OIDC, SAML, and identity-proofing mechanisms.
- Experience with SAP CDC (Gigya) is preferred, CIAM platforms like Okta, Ping, Auth0, or ForgeRock are considered.
- Strong background in fraud detection, bot mitigation, and risk-based authentication.
- Understanding of cryptographic principles, token security, and identity governance frameworks.
- Demonstrated ability to align CIAM security with business needs and compliance requirements.
